Normal Difficulty

Normal difficulty is the starting point for most players, and it is designed for players who are new to the game or are looking for a more relaxed experience. Normal difficulty dungeons and raids have a moderate level of challenge, with encounters that require basic strategies and coordination.

Heroic Difficulty

Heroic difficulty is a step up from Normal, and it requires more strategy and coordination to complete. Heroic difficulty dungeons and raids have increased difficulty levels, with added mechanics and more challenging enemies.

Mythic Difficulty

Mythic difficulty is the most challenging level, and it is designed for experienced players who are looking for a significant challenge. Mythic difficulty dungeons and raids have extremely high difficulty levels, with complex mechanics and enemies that require expert-level coordination and strategy.
